    Getting Around:

    Sea Ranch is located on the Sonoma Coast, approximately 2.5 hours north of San Francisco via Highway 101 to Highway 1. The closest airport is Charles M. Schulz-Sonoma County Airport (STS) in Santa Rosa, about 1.5 hours east. A car is essential for exploring the area. The scenic drive along Highway 1 is part of the experience.



    Other Things to Note:

    Sea Ranch has three recreation centers with heated pools, saunas, and tennis courts. Access passes are provided with your stay -- check availability upon arrival as these shared amenities can be popular during peak times.



    Exterior lighting is minimal by design to preserve the stunning dark sky -- bring a flashlight for evening walks and enjoy some of the best stargazing on the California coast.



    December through April is whale season. You may spot gray whales breaching right from the bluff trail nearby. Wildflower season (April-June) transforms the coastal bluffs into a tapestry of color -- worth an extra walk on the trails. Summer offers long days and warm afternoons, though the iconic Sonoma Coast fog often rolls in at sunrise and clears by noon.



    Cell service can be spotty along the coast. The home has WiFi for staying connected.
